2025 UAE Visa Requirements for Indian Citizens. The United Arab Emirates (UAE) is a popular destination for Indian travelers, whether for tourism, business, or work. Before traveling, all Indian citizens must obtain a visa. This can be done through the UAE embassy or consulate in India or via the official UAE visa portal. The type of visa required depends on the purpose of the visit. Below is a comprehensive guide on UAE visa requirements for Indian citizens.

2025 UAE Visa Requirements for Indian Citizens

  • A valid Indian passport (with at least six months validity from the travel date).
  • Recent passport-sized photographs.
  • Confirmed return flight tickets.
  • Proof of accommodation (hotel bookings or invitation letter from a UAE resident).
  • Bank statements showing financial stability (for certain visa types).
  • Travel insurance (if applicable).
  • Employment letter or invitation letter (for business/work visa).

Types of UAE Visas for Indian Citizens

  1. Tourist Visa
    • Ideal for Indian travelers visiting UAE for leisure or vacations.
    • Available for 30 or 90 days (single or multiple entry).
    • Can be applied online via UAE government portals, travel agencies, or airlines.
  2. Business Visa
    • Designed for Indian professionals attending business meetings, conferences, or trade shows.
    • Requires an invitation from a UAE-based company.
    • Usually issued for short-term stays.
  3. Work Visa
    • Mandatory for Indian citizens seeking employment in the UAE.
    • Requires sponsorship from a UAE employer.
    • Issued after approval from the UAE Ministry of Human Resources and Emiratisation (MOHRE).
  4. Transit Visa
    • Suitable for Indian travelers transiting through the UAE.
    • Available for 48 or 96 hours.
    • Can be obtained through airlines facilitating UAE layovers.
  5. Student Visa
    • Issued to Indian students enrolled in UAE-based educational institutions.
    • Requires proof of admission and financial support.
  6. Residence Visa
    • For Indian citizens moving to the UAE for long-term residence.
    • Includes family visas, investor visas, and Golden Visas for high-net-worth individuals.

UAE Visa Application Process for Indian Citizens

1. Online Application

  • Visit the official UAE visa portal or authorized visa service providers.
  • Choose the type of visa required.
  • Fill out the application form with personal and travel details.
  • Upload the required documents.
  • Pay the visa processing fee.
  • Receive visa approval via email.

2. Embassy/Consulate Application

  • Visit the nearest UAE embassy or consulate in India.
  • Submit the necessary documents and visa application form.
  • Pay the required fees.
  • Wait for visa approval and collection.

Visa fees vary depending on the type and duration of the visa. Generally:

  • Tourist Visa (30 days): Approx. INR 6,000 – 8,000
  • Tourist Visa (90 days): Approx. INR 15,000 – 20,000
  • Business Visa: Approx. INR 10,000 – 15,000
  • Work Visa: Fees depend on employer sponsorship and job category.
  • Transit Visa (48 hours): Free (via UAE airlines)
  • Transit Visa (96 hours): Approx. INR 1,500 – 2,000

Processing Time for UAE Visas

  • Tourist & Business Visa: 3 to 5 working days
  • Work Visa: 10 to 15 working days
  • Student Visa: 7 to 10 working days
  • Transit Visa: 1 to 2 working days

Visa-on-Arrival for Indian Citizens

Indian passport holders with a valid US visa, UK visa, Schengen visa, or residence permit from select countries can obtain a 14-day visa-on-arrival in the UAE. The visa-on-arrival fee is around AED 100 and can be extended for an additional 14 days.
